About Sonamara Village

Sonamara is a small village in Chakradharpur tehsil, in the district of Pashchimi Singhbhum, Jharkhand.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 193, made up of 99 males and 94 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 949 females per 1000 males. The village covers 125 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 833102,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Sonamara

The census records public bus service for Sonamara as Available within <5 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 10+ km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
